Angela Poore Fleck
April 21, 1962 – January 9, 2013

Angela Poore Fleck, 50, of Lexington, S.C. and formerly of Lynchburg, died Wednesday, January 9, 2013, in Lexington, S.C. She was the wife of Mark A. Fleck.
Born in Lynchburg, she was the daughter of the late Curtis Cleveland Poore and the late Betty Eskridge Poore. In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by one sister, Frances Collins and two brothers, Curtis Poore, Jr. and Eugene Poore.
Angela was a member of the Assembly of God in Lynchburg and was a retired social worker with Perot Data Systems.
In addition to her husband, she is survived by one daughter, Katherine Fleck of Lexington, S.C.; one son, Joshua Fleck of Lexington, S.C.; two brothers, Marvin Poore of Lynchburg and Steve Brooks of Tampa, FL and a special friend, Janet Dawson of Lexington, S.C. When her mother died, she was cared for by Kenneth and Connie Fulcher, Sr. of Lynchburg.
A funeral service will be conducted at 11:00 a.m., Saturday, January 12, 2013, at Whitten Timberlake Chapel with the Reverend David Rowland officiating. Interment will follow in Fort Hill Memorial Park.
The family will receive friends from 7:00 to 8:30 p.m., today, January 11, 2013, at Whitten Timberlake Chapel and at other times , at the residence of Debra Burnley, 112 Sherbrooke Dr., Lynchburg, VA 24502.
